POSITION TITLE: CTAE Director
LOCATION: Jones County High School
REPORTS TO: Assistant Superintendent of Teaching, Learning, and Whole Child Support
Effective Date: November 2, 2026
FLSA Status:Â Exempt
Starting Salary:Â $112.000 - $114,000 (commensurate with educational background/experience)
Position PurposeÂ
The CTAE Director serves as the visionary leader of the College and Career Academy (CCA) and the external-facing leader for the Jones County School System (JCSS) CCA. The position provides strategic leadership for the continuous improvement of CCA programs, operations, and partnerships. The CTAE Director develops and maintains strategic partnerships with business and industry, postsecondary institutions, community organizations, and government agencies to strengthen curriculum, programming, and workforce development opportunities. Using data-driven processes for planning, implementation, and monitoring, the position directs administrative, curricular, and instructional services designed to improve student outcomes, expand college and career opportunities, and align CCA programs with local workforce needs.
